Encasing the serrated barb is a thin layer of flesh which serves as a sheath, concentrating the venom within. The underside of the barb contains a pair of grooves which act as a channel for a set of venom glands. Aside from the pain and serious laceration caused by the razor-sharp barb, which can sever arteries and possibly an Achilles tendon, a poison is released that can produce a drastic decrease in blood pressure, increased pulse, dizziness and possible shock.
